Fly Fishing School – June 19th (Father’s Day)
Great gift idea for Dad! Sign up for our June fly fishing school, taught by our head guide Ron Rhodes (who also teaches the Dartmouth fly fishing class). Whether you have never tried fly fishing before, or just can’t get rid of that “tailing loop”, you will walk away having learned a great deal more than you expected. We cover everything from equipment and casting instruction to insect identification, knot tying and fish location.
Our school includes the following:
9 AM to 4 PM – Classroom style information on equipment, reading the water, entomology, knots, fly selection and safe wading techniques. You will receive a free copy of the Orvis Fly Fishing 101 book also to refer back to after class. All casting instruction takes place on the water at Storrs Pond. Ron will have all the equipment (rods, reels, line, etc.), but feel free to bring your own if you want.
